KINGDOM'S HOPE by Chuck Black
This is such a great series to read which is shy it's landing on my Sarah's Favorites Booklist! Obviously, I have only read the first two of the six book series, but I expect just as great of content in those as I have encountered in the first two so far.
Imagine taking well known Bible stories and loosely converting them into a medieval time period tale. That is exactly what Chuck Black has done in this series. What you end up with is a story that pursues concepts such as truth, bravery, sacrifice, and devotion and loyalty to the True King, Character traits that we all pray our children develop within their own lives.
As the main character, Leinad, moves through Kingdom's Hope, readers will recognize him take on the persona of the Biblical characters Moses, Elijah, Daniel, Nehemiah, and others as he encounters situations that will be similarly based to the Biblical stories but with a twist to them. This is such a brilliant way to construct a story, and there are so many options on how to use it. If your children have a decent knowledge of the Biblical accounts, see if they recognize them within the story. If they don't, what a perfect time to read the story and then pair it with the true Biblical account. It's a win win no matter what the approach. Of course, there is always the option of handing them a story to just read bursting with goodness and truth that will hopefully inspire them in their own lives. I think that means we just landed on a win win win with this book!
A couple of ending notes:
-Chuck Black is a former F-16 fighter pilot. That means he knows his battle "stuff" and how to portray them within a story!
-At the end of the book is an extensive Discussion Questions section that reveals the parallels the book makes to the Bible along with an Author's Commentary on the representations. Black lays it all out for us, so we don't have to worry about making guesses to the intentions.
